France lost defense due to Trump's victory
The French Foreign Minister Jean-Noel Barro said that Europe lost its defense capability after Trump's victory and must quickly respond to several serious challenges to avoid becoming a 'museum exhibit'.
The Minister believes that Europe needs to expand its capabilities in line with military, industrial and commercial needs.
'We must prevent a future where Europe becomes an aging and dependent continent. Currently, 80% of the weapons and military equipment used by European armies come from other countries. This is an unacceptable dependency,' Barro noted.
Barro emphasized that Europe decisively opposes the promised increase in tariffs on European goods by Trump and the possibility of a trade war.
'Imposing tariffs on the EU, our main partner, would be a historic mistake. This will harm numerous American companies operating in Europe. But we will vigorously defend our agricultural, industrial, commercial, and technological interests against the US, China, and any other country,' the Minister stressed.
He also expressed concern about the possible appointment of Elon Musk to a position in the new US administration.
'We hope he will not do to American democracy what he did to Twitter,' Barro said.
